Overview of Anaesthetic Billing Processes and Challenges
Anaesthetic billing involves several key steps, including patient registration, service documentation, coding, charge entry, and claims submission. Each of these steps must be executed with precision to ensure accurate reimbursement. However, anaesthetic practices often face challenges such as fluctuating payer policies, the need for detailed documentation, and the complexities of anesthesia billing codes. Additionally, the fast-paced environment of surgical settings can lead to rushed billing practices, resulting in errors that can compromise revenue cycle management.
The requirement for compliance with regulations and payer guidelines adds another layer of complexity. Practices must stay updated on coding changes and billing protocols to minimize the risk of audits and denials. Given these challenges, anaesthetic practices can benefit from streamlined billing processes that enhance efficiency and accuracy.
Benefits of Using Specialized Billing Software for Anaesthetic Practices
Utilizing anaesthetic billing organization solutions can significantly alleviate the burdens associated with billing processes. These solutions are specifically designed to address the unique needs of anaesthetic practices, offering features that enhance both efficiency and compliance.
Key Features and Functionalities
One of the primary benefits of specialized billing software is its ability to automate various aspects of the billing process. Automation reduces the manual workload for staff, minimizing the risk of human error. Additionally, these solutions often include comprehensive coding databases that ensure accurate coding and billing, which can lead to faster claim approvals and payments.
Another key feature is the integration of electronic health records (EHR) with billing systems. This integration allows for seamless data transfer between patient records and billing information, further reducing errors and improving documentation accuracy. Furthermore, specialized billing software typically offers robust reporting tools, enabling practices to analyze their revenue cycles, identify trends, and make informed decisions about financial management.

Choosing the Right Billing Organization Solution
When selecting a solution for anaesthetic billing organization, practices should consider several critical factors. First and foremost, the software should offer a user-friendly interface that allows staff to navigate easily without extensive training. This is vital in a busy clinical environment where time is of the essence.
Additionally, ensure that the solution provides robust compliance features. This includes regular updates to coding databases and adherence to regulatory standards, which can help mitigate the risk of audits and denials. Look for a solution that offers excellent customer support and training resources, as these can be invaluable during the implementation phase and beyond.
